XMLNodesCollection Interfaz
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Contiene una colección de nodos DOM (Modelo de objetos de documento) XML.
public interface class XMLNodesCollection : Microsoft::Office::Interop::InfoPath::XMLNodes
[System.Runtime.InteropServices.Guid("096CD6C1-0786-11D1-95FA-0080C78EE3BB")]
public interface XMLNodesCollection : Microsoft.Office.Interop.InfoPath.XMLNodes
type XMLNodesCollection = interface
interface XMLNodes
Public Interface XMLNodesCollection
Implements XMLNodes
- Derivado
- Atributos
- Implementaciones
Ejemplos
En el ejemplo siguiente, una referencia se establece en una colección de nodos DOM XML devueltos por el método GetSelectedNodes del ViewObject objeto . A continuación, el código muestra el nombre y el código XML del primer nodo de la colección, mediante un cuadro de mensaje:
<span class="label">XMLNodes</span> selectedNodes;
selectedNodes = thisXDocument.View.GetSelectedNodes();
if (selectedNodes.Count > 0)
{
thisXDocument.UI.Alert(selectedNodes[0].nodeName + "\n\n" + selectedNodes[0].text);
}
Comentarios
Este tipo es un contenedor para una interfaz COM implementada por una coclase que requiere el código administrado para la interoperabilidad con COM. Para acceder a los miembros que especifica esta interfaz, utilice el tipo que contiene la coclase que implementa esta interfaz. Para obtener información sobre ese tipo, incluidos el uso, los comentarios y los ejemplos, consulteXMLNodes .
La colección XMLNodesCollection es una colección de uso general que usan varios métodos de Microsoft Office InfoPath 2003.
La colección XMLNodesCollection proporciona propiedades que se pueden usar para tener acceso a una colección de nodos XML DOM, y la devuelven los GetSelectedNodes() métodos y GetContextNodes(Object, Object) .
Una vez establecida una referencia a uno de los objetos de nodo XML DOM contenidos en la colección XMLNodesCollection, puede utilizar cualquiera de las propiedades y métodos que proporciona el XML DOM para interactuar con un objeto de nodo XML.
Propiedades
Count |
Obtiene un recuento del número de objetos de nodo del modelo de objetos de documento (DOM) XML contenidos en la XMLNodesCollection colección. (Heredado de XMLNodes) |
Item[Object] |
Obtiene una referencia al nodo XML Document Object Model (DOM) especificado de la XMLNodesCollection colección. (Heredado de XMLNodes) |
Métodos
GetEnumerator() |
Obtiene un IEnumerator que recorre en iteración todas las entradas del XMLNodesCollection objeto . (Heredado de XMLNodes) |